Good to Know
Pontiac is in Livingston County on Historic Route 66 — the Route 66 Museum in Pontiac is a destination for road trip enthusiasts, and the surrounding prairie is prime corn country.
Livingston County Fair Overview
The Livingston County Fair, based in Pontiac, is a four-day mid-July celebration in east-central Illinois, serving the agricultural communities of Livingston County along Route 66.
Highlights
Expect livestock judging, 4-H competitions, carnival rides, local food vendors, and the community spirit of one of Illinois's larger farming counties.
